IMO, the best way to compare is best to best, stock to stock. An LS2 GTO will run a 12.9 @ 109mph. A G8 GT 13.6 @ 104mph or so. Similar to an LS1 GTO, 4-5mph slower than an LS2.

If you're gonna go best for best then the best G8 that I've found went 13.39 and I've seen a couple trap 106 mph, but I'm not sure what the official fastest time is. Still slower than the LS2 GTO, but that's definitely expected when the GTO weighs over 200 lbs more and makes at least 30 more rwhp. I think the G8 GT is more comparable to an LS1 GTO and the G8 GXP should be a great race for an LS2 GTO.

What suprised me is that an LS1 GTO weighs over 200 lbs less than me and makes the same rwhp, but even from a roll I was able to slightly pull it.
